Clinical application of low energy intracardiac cardioversion of atrial fibrillation / 介入放射学杂志

ABSTRACT
Objective To evaluate the efficacy and safety of low energy intracardiac cardioversion in persistent atrial fibrillation. Methods Low energy intracardiac cardioversion was performed by delivering R wave synchronized biphasic shocks in 7 patients(4 men, 3 women) with persistent atrial fibrillation. Prior to the procedure, all patients underwent transesophageal echocardiographic examinations to rule out the presence of intracardiac thrombus and received subcutaneous injection of low molecular weight heparin for 3 5 days. Two custom made 6 Fr catheters(Rhythm Technologies of Getz, USA) were used for de fibrillation shock delivery. One catheter was positioned in the lower right atrium so that the majority of the catheter electrodes had firm contact with the right atrial free wall. The second catheter was placed randomly either in coronary sinus through right internal jugular vein or in the left pulmonary artery through femoral vein. In addition, a standard diagnostic 6 F quadropolar catheter was placed at the right ventricular apex for ventricular synchronization and postshock ventricular pacing. Shocks were delivered by Implant Support Device(Model 4510, Teleceronics). After conversion, all patients were treated with intravenous amiodarone in the first 24 hours followed by oral administration. Results In all 7 patients cardioversion of atrial fibrillation to sinus rhythm was successfully obtained. A mean of 2?1 shocks per patient has been delivered with a total amount of 13 shocks. The average delivered energy was 7.8?2.2 Joules. No complication occurred. At a mean follow up of 18?9 months, 4 of the 7 patients treated successfully showed sinus rhythm there after. Atrial fibrillation recurred in 3 patients at the second, fifth day and eighth month after cardioversion. Conclusions Low energy intracardiac cardioversion is effective and safe, and can be easily performed in patients without geneal anesthesia. It offers a new option for restoring sinus rhythm in patients with persistent atrial fibrillation.
